PRO BLEM PRO BABLE

CAUS E

REMEDY

No heat (Heater

1.

Incorrect manifold pressure or orifices. 1. Check manifold pressure (See Paragraph 12).

O perating)

2.

Cycling on limit control.

2.

Check air throughput.

3.

Improper thermostat location or

adjustment.

3.

See thermostat manufacturer's instructions.

Cold air delivered 1.

Incorrect manifold pressure.

1.

Check manifold pressure (See Paragraph 12).

1.

Circuit open.

1.

Check wiring and connections.

2.

Defective integrated circuit board.

2.

Replace board.

3.

Defective motor.

3.

Replace motor.

Motor turns on &
off while burner is
operating (S ee
below)

1.

M otor overload device cycling on and

off.

1.

Check motor load against motor rating plate. Replace motor if needed.

Fan motor cuts

1.

Low or high voltage supply .

1.

Correct electric supply.

out on overload

2.

Defective motor.

2.

Replace motor.

3.

Poor air flow.

3.

Clean motor, fan and fan guard.

4.

Defective bearing or lubrication.

4.

Lubricate bearings or replace motor.

Motor will not run
